Former NRL star Johnathan Thurston believes that South Sydney Rabbitohs player Latrell Mitchell is likely to be suspended after being sin-binned for a high tackle on Sua Fa'alogo during a game against the Melbourne Storm.

Mitchell made heavy contact with Fa'alogo's head with his shoulder, resulting in Fa'alogo failing his HIA and being ruled out for the next match against Canberra.

Despite opinions being divided on whether Mitchell should be suspended, his previous poor disciplinary record and the lateness of the hit may work against him.
